Preparation, antioxidant and immunomodulatory activities of selenium-modified galactomannan

Abstract:
In this study, selenylation modification of Gleditsia sinensis galactomannan (GSG) was carried out using the HNO3-Na2SeO3 method, successfully yielding the selenylated product (SeGSG). Structural characterization confirmed that selenium was introduced into the GSG chain via the formation of C-O-Se covalent bond at the C6-hydroxyl sites. This modification altered the polymerization degree and structure of GSG, thereby significantly enhancing its in vitro antioxidant capacity. Biological assays demonstrated that SeGSG exhibited markedly lower developmental toxicity in zebrafish than Na2SeO3, indicating improved biosafety. In an LPS-induced zebrafish inflammation model, SeGSG effectively alleviated oxidative stress and liver injury. This protective effect was attributed to the modulation of antioxidant-related genes (Sod-2, Gclc) and immune-related genes (NF-κB, IL-1β), which subsequently lowered reactive oxygen species and nitric oxide levels. This study demonstrates that selenylation modification significantly enhances the bioactivity and biosafety of GSG, providing an experimental foundation for developing SeGSG as a novel functional food ingredient.
